Transaction caa973663432c73d72921114c14d5fc97187c8772f519140ce947f8478e0a9b2
1 Input
1 Output
-
caa973663432c73d72921114c14d5fc97187c8772f519140ce947f8478e0a9b2:0
- value
- 11918000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5424043ad05baf67fdd1ac778e35413574de9b01 OP_EQUAL
- address
- 39Muq8TR6FuA16ovyw629bEAe2MAXgxGxv